What Actually Causes Bad Breath?
One of the first things I learned about bad breath is that there is rarely one universal cause. The odor can develop for several different reasons, and sometimes more than one factor is involved at the same time.
According to dental and medical authorities, a large percentage of persistent bad breath originates inside the mouth. The mouth naturally contains many species of bacteria. Most are simply part of the normal oral ecosystem, but when certain bacteria break down food debris, dead cells, and proteins, they can release unpleasant-smelling substances.
Among the most important of these are volatile sulfur compounds, often abbreviated as VSCs. These compounds can create odors people describe as sulfurous, rotten, or egg-like.
I find it useful to think about the mouth as an ecosystem rather than a sterile environment. The goal is not to eliminate every bacterium. That would neither be practical nor desirable. Instead, good oral care reduces the accumulation of plaque, food debris, and tongue coating that can provide odor-producing bacteria with an ideal environment.
This is also why brushing alone sometimes fails to completely solve bad breath. Teeth are only part of the oral environment.
The Tongue Is One of the First Places I Would Check
If somebody told me they brushed carefully twice a day but still struggled with bad breath, one of the first things I would ask about is tongue cleaning.
The surface of the tongue contains countless tiny grooves and structures where bacteria, dead cells, food particles, and other debris can accumulate. This is particularly noticeable toward the back of the tongue, where a whitish or yellowish coating can sometimes develop.
That coating may contribute significantly to oral odor.
I personally think tongue cleaning is one of the most overlooked parts of a breath-freshening routine because most people grow up hearing about brushing and flossing while the tongue barely gets mentioned.
A tongue scraper can be useful, although a toothbrush can also be used. I would gently work from farther back on the tongue toward the front rather than aggressively scrubbing. Excessive pressure is unnecessary and can irritate the tongue.
The objective is simply to reduce the coating where odor-producing bacteria and debris can accumulate.
I also would not obsessively scrape the tongue throughout the day. Gentle cleaning once or twice daily is generally more sensible than repeatedly irritating the tissue in pursuit of perfectly odorless breath.
Brushing Correctly Matters More Than Brushing Aggressively
Everyone knows brushing is important, but technique and consistency matter just as much as owning a good toothbrush.
If I were trying to get rid of bad breath, I would brush thoroughly twice per day for approximately two minutes rather than doing a rushed thirty-second scrub. I would pay attention to the gumline and the harder-to-reach back teeth instead of concentrating exclusively on the visible front teeth.
Plaque can accumulate where the teeth meet the gums, and gum problems are an important potential contributor to chronic bad breath.
I would also use a fluoride toothpaste for cavity protection unless my dentist recommended something different.
Something else I would avoid is trying to solve bad breath by brushing harder. Aggressive brushing does not necessarily clean better. Over time, excessive force can irritate the gums and contribute to toothbrush abrasion.
Good brushing is thorough but gentle.
Flossing Can Make a Surprisingly Big Difference
If there is one quick experiment that demonstrates why flossing matters for breath, it is smelling a piece of floss after cleaning an area that has been neglected.
It is not particularly glamorous, but it makes the point.
Food particles and plaque easily collect between teeth where an ordinary toothbrush cannot reach effectively. When that material remains trapped, oral bacteria can break it down and produce unpleasant odors.
This is why someone can brush carefully and still experience bad breath.
I would clean between my teeth every day using traditional dental floss, interdental brushes, a water flosser, or another method recommended by my dentist. The best option depends partly on tooth spacing, dental restorations, braces, gum condition, and personal dexterity.
The important thing is not necessarily which interdental tool wins a popularity contest. The important thing is actually cleaning areas that a toothbrush cannot adequately reach.
Persistent bleeding during flossing should also get my attention. Occasional bleeding can happen when someone starts flossing neglected gums, but ongoing bleeding, swelling, tenderness, or gum recession deserves professional evaluation because gum disease can contribute to chronic breath odor.
Gum Disease Is a Cause I Would Never Ignore
Persistent bad breath can sometimes be associated with gingivitis or more advanced periodontal disease.
When plaque accumulates around the gums, inflammation can develop. If periodontal disease progresses, pockets can form between the teeth and gums where bacteria and debris become increasingly difficult to remove through ordinary home care.
At that point, constantly chewing breath mints is not addressing the real problem.
Signs that would make me more suspicious of a gum issue include gums that bleed easily, persistent redness or swelling, gum recession, loose teeth, tenderness when chewing, or a consistently unpleasant taste.
Professional dental cleaning and periodontal treatment can be necessary when deposits have hardened into calculus or when gum disease has progressed.
This is one of the reasons I consider dental visits an important part of solving chronic bad breath rather than merely a way of keeping teeth white.
Dry Mouth Can Make Bad Breath Much Worse
Saliva is one of the body’s natural cleaning mechanisms for the mouth. It moistens oral tissues and helps wash away food particles and other material.
When saliva production decreases, the mouth becomes an easier environment for odor to develop.
This helps explain why morning breath is so common. Saliva flow naturally decreases during sleep, giving bacteria and debris more opportunity to accumulate before morning.
However, some people experience dry mouth throughout the day.
I would look at several possible contributors, including dehydration, mouth breathing, tobacco use, certain medications, alcohol, and medical conditions affecting saliva production.
If I simply had mild dryness because I had not been drinking enough fluids, increasing water intake would be an obvious place to start.
For ongoing dry mouth, sugar-free chewing gum may encourage saliva production in some people. Sugar-free candies can sometimes serve a similar purpose. Products designed specifically for dry mouth are another possibility.
Persistent dry mouth, however, deserves more attention because saliva is important not only for breath but also for protecting teeth and oral tissues.
If my mouth constantly felt dry despite drinking water, I would mention it to my dentist or healthcare provider rather than assuming it was harmless.
Mouth Breathing May Be Part of the Problem
Another factor people sometimes overlook is how they breathe, particularly during sleep.
Chronic mouth breathing can dry the oral tissues, reducing the protective effect of saliva and potentially worsening morning breath.
Nasal congestion, allergies, anatomical airway problems, or sleep-related breathing issues can sometimes contribute.
If I regularly woke up with an extremely dry mouth, bad breath, or a dry throat, I would pay attention to whether I might be sleeping with my mouth open.
This does not mean I would try to diagnose the cause myself. Persistent nasal obstruction, snoring, or difficulty breathing comfortably through the nose is something I would discuss with an appropriate healthcare professional.
Drink Enough Water Throughout the Day
Water is not a miracle cure for halitosis, but hydration supports a healthier oral environment.
When I go long periods without drinking anything, particularly after coffee or meals, my mouth can feel noticeably less fresh.
Sipping water throughout the day helps rinse away some food debris and supports normal saliva production.
It becomes particularly useful after drinking coffee, eating protein-heavy meals, or consuming foods with lingering aromas.
Water should not be treated as a substitute for brushing or flossing, of course. It is more of a supporting habit.
I would also be cautious about constantly sipping sugary beverages for the sake of having something in my mouth. Regular exposure to sugar can encourage tooth decay and feed oral bacteria.
Plain water remains the simplest everyday option.
Coffee Can Be a Bigger Breath Problem Than I Expect
I enjoy coffee, so I would never pretend that getting rid of bad breath automatically requires abandoning it.
Still, coffee can contribute to unpleasant breath in several ways. Its aroma can linger, and depending on how it is consumed, it may leave the mouth feeling dry. Milk, cream, or sweetened coffee beverages can also leave residues oral bacteria may act upon.
Instead of giving up coffee altogether, I would drink water afterward and maintain regular brushing and interdental cleaning.
If bad breath seemed noticeably worse on days when I consumed several cups, I would experiment with reducing the amount and see whether there was a meaningful difference.
The broader lesson is that small daily habits can sometimes reveal patterns that are easy to overlook.
Garlic, Onions, and Strong Foods Are Different
Some bad breath does not come only from food particles sitting in the mouth.
Compounds from strongly aromatic foods such as garlic and onions can be absorbed into the bloodstream during digestion and eventually expelled through the lungs.
That means brushing immediately after eating garlic may clean the mouth but cannot instantly eliminate every odor associated with the meal.
This type of bad breath generally improves as the body processes the compounds.
Water, oral hygiene, and sugar-free gum can make the situation more manageable, but sometimes time is simply part of the solution.
Understanding this helped me stop expecting mouthwash to perform an impossible job.
Smoking and Tobacco Can Keep Breath Persistently Unpleasant
If someone wants to know how to get rid of bad breath but regularly smokes or uses tobacco, that habit deserves serious consideration.
Tobacco products can produce their own lingering odor and are also associated with dry mouth and oral health problems, including gum disease.
That creates several possible pathways to chronic bad breath at once.
Quitting tobacco has benefits that extend far beyond breath, including major benefits for oral and overall health. For someone finding it difficult to quit, professional cessation support can be worthwhile.
From a breath perspective alone, trying to overpower tobacco odor with mints or mouthwash is unlikely to address the underlying problem.
Choosing a Mouthwash for Bad Breath
Mouthwash can absolutely have a place in a good oral care routine, but I would distinguish between cosmetic mouthwash and therapeutic mouthwash.
A cosmetic rinse primarily makes the mouth taste or smell fresher temporarily. That can be useful before a meeting or social event, but the benefit may be short-lived.
Therapeutic mouthrinses contain active ingredients intended to address factors such as plaque, gingivitis, cavities, or odor-producing bacteria.
The American Dental Association notes that certain therapeutic formulations may contain ingredients such as cetylpyridinium chloride, essential oils, chlorhexidine, peroxide, or fluoride, depending on their intended purpose. Zinc compounds can also be used in some breath-focused formulations because they can interact with odor-producing sulfur compounds.
I would choose a mouthwash according to the actual oral-health problem I was trying to address rather than simply picking whichever bottle promised the strongest mint flavor.
Someone with significant dry mouth may also want to pay particular attention to formulations designed with dryness in mind.
Most importantly, mouthwash should complement brushing and interdental cleaning rather than replace them.
Sugar-Free Gum Can Be More Useful Than Breath Mints
There are times when I cannot brush immediately after eating, and this is where sugar-free chewing gum can be useful.
Chewing stimulates saliva, which helps wash the mouth and can reduce the dry feeling that often contributes to stale breath.
I prefer this approach over continually sucking on sugary breath candies because repeated sugar exposure is not particularly friendly to teeth.
A mint can still provide temporary freshness, but I think of mints as cosmetic tools rather than treatment.
If I find myself needing a mint every thirty minutes just to feel comfortable speaking to people, that is a sign I should investigate why the odor keeps returning.
Clean Dentures, Retainers, and Oral Appliances Thoroughly
Bad breath does not necessarily come directly from natural teeth.
Dentures, retainers, mouthguards, aligners, and other removable appliances can collect bacteria and debris if they are not cleaned appropriately.
Someone can brush perfectly and then immediately reintroduce odor-producing material by placing an inadequately cleaned appliance back into the mouth.
I would follow the cleaning instructions provided for the specific appliance rather than automatically using ordinary toothpaste, which can be too abrasive for some materials.
Dentures should receive particularly careful attention, including professional evaluation when they no longer fit correctly.
If an appliance consistently develops an unpleasant smell even with proper cleaning, I would ask my dentist about it.
What About Tonsil Stones?
Tonsil stones are another potential source of unpleasant breath that people sometimes discover only after everything else seems normal.
These small deposits can form within crevices of the tonsils and may contain food particles, minerals, bacteria, and cellular debris. They can produce a particularly unpleasant odor.
Not everyone with tonsil stones has significant symptoms, and repeatedly digging at the tonsils is not something I would recommend.
If tonsil stones were frequent, uncomfortable, or associated with persistent bad breath, I would discuss them with a healthcare professional or ear, nose, and throat specialist.
Again, solving bad breath works best when I identify its origin rather than continually masking it.
Acid Reflux Can Sometimes Be Involved
Although most bad breath begins in the mouth, there are circumstances where gastrointestinal or other medical conditions may contribute.
Acid reflux is one possibility.
Reflux can cause a sour taste and other unpleasant sensations in the mouth, and frequent exposure to stomach acid can affect dental enamel as well.
If my bad breath occurred together with frequent heartburn, regurgitation, sour taste, chronic throat irritation, or similar reflux symptoms, I would not assume that stronger mouthwash was the answer.
I would discuss those symptoms with a healthcare provider.
This is also why I am cautious whenever someone claims that all bad breath originates in the stomach. In reality, oral causes are extremely important and often more common, but persistent symptoms sometimes require looking beyond the mouth.

Can Probiotics Help With Bad Breath?
The relationship between the oral microbiome and halitosis is an interesting area of research.
Because bacteria play such an important role in producing volatile sulfur compounds, researchers have studied whether particular probiotic strains could help alter the microbial environment of the mouth.
Systematic reviews and clinical studies have reported potentially beneficial effects from certain probiotics in some circumstances, but results are not uniform enough for me to call probiotics a universal cure for bad breath.
Different products contain different organisms, different dosages, and different delivery systems. A probiotic swallowed immediately into the digestive tract is also not necessarily equivalent to a lozenge or oral product designed to interact with the mouth.
For that reason, I would consider probiotics an emerging or complementary option rather than a replacement for established oral hygiene.
The most important question remains: What is causing the bad breath in this specific person?
If the real cause is periodontal disease, a probiotic is unlikely to solve the problem on its own.
My Practical Daily Routine for Fresher Breath
If I wanted the simplest realistic routine for controlling ordinary mouth-related bad breath, I would start with consistency rather than an enormous collection of products.
In the morning, I would brush carefully for about two minutes and gently clean my tongue. If I regularly woke with a dry mouth, I would also pay attention to hydration and possible mouth breathing.
During the day, I would drink water regularly, particularly after coffee or meals. When brushing was not practical, sugar-free gum could help stimulate saliva and freshen the mouth temporarily.
At some point during the day, I would clean between my teeth thoroughly. Some people prefer flossing at night because it removes material accumulated throughout the day, which is perfectly reasonable.
Before bed, I would brush again carefully and make sure I was not leaving food debris between my teeth overnight.
If using a therapeutic mouthwash, I would follow the product directions rather than assuming more frequent use automatically produces better results.
That routine is relatively simple, but simplicity is one of its strengths. A complicated twenty-step oral-care ritual is useless if I stop following it after four days.
Why Morning Breath Happens Even When My Teeth Are Clean
Morning breath is not automatically a sign of poor hygiene.
Saliva production decreases during sleep, and the mouth receives less of the natural rinsing action it gets while I am awake, drinking water, chewing, and swallowing.
That gives bacteria more opportunity to act on available proteins and debris.
The situation can become more noticeable if I sleep with my mouth open, drink alcohol before bed, smoke, have chronic nasal congestion, or already experience dry mouth.
Cleaning my teeth, flossing, and tongue before sleeping can reduce the amount of material available to oral bacteria overnight, but it may not make morning breath disappear completely.
Some degree of morning breath is normal.
The concern becomes greater when the odor remains strong throughout the day despite good oral hygiene.
Mistakes I Would Avoid When Trying to Get Rid of Bad Breath
One mistake is relying almost entirely on breath mints. Mints can change what the mouth smells like temporarily, but they rarely address the underlying reason the odor developed.
Another mistake is excessively brushing or scraping the tongue. More force does not necessarily mean better hygiene and may irritate delicate tissues.
I would also avoid assuming that bad breath always comes from the stomach. The mouth is an extremely common source, which is why dental evaluation is often an appropriate first step when home care fails.
At the same time, I would avoid the opposite mistake of assuming every case is purely dental. Persistent symptoms sometimes involve dry mouth, medications, respiratory conditions, reflux, systemic diseases, or other health problems.
Finally, I would be cautious with online products claiming to permanently cure bad breath within days regardless of its cause. Halitosis has too many possible causes for one universal solution to make sense.
How Quickly Can Bad Breath Improve?
The answer depends completely on what is causing it.
If the problem is mostly food debris, tongue coating, mild dehydration, or inconsistent flossing, someone may notice improvement relatively quickly after correcting those habits.
Bad breath related to gum disease, cavities, infection, chronic dry mouth, tonsil problems, or another medical issue may require professional treatment before meaningful long-term improvement occurs.
That is why I would focus less on finding a specific number of days and more on observing whether the odor steadily improves after improving oral hygiene.
If there is no clear improvement despite consistently brushing, flossing, tongue cleaning, and staying hydrated, I would take that lack of progress as useful information.
It suggests the problem may require professional investigation.
When I Would See a Dentist About Bad Breath
I would not wait indefinitely if bad breath persisted despite good home care.
A dentist can examine areas I simply cannot evaluate properly myself. That includes cavities, periodontal pockets, infections, calculus buildup, failing restorations, denture problems, and other oral conditions.
I would be particularly motivated to make an appointment if bad breath occurred with bleeding gums, gum swelling, tooth pain, loose teeth, pus or drainage, sores that do not heal, unusual oral growths, or significant persistent dry mouth.
If a dental examination showed that the mouth was healthy, the next step might be discussing other possible causes with a physician or another healthcare professional.
Persistent bad breath is common, but it should not automatically be dismissed as cosmetic.
